Sucesses And Failures Of Idents (draft 1)
Idents are small advertisements that market a channel. They have both opportunities and limitations. Some opportunities Idents have is that they create a corporate identity and a tone for your channel. Also it easily displays text-based information about your channel. Idents allows you to brand your channel, so it appeals to your target audience. Another opportunity is that it encourages brand loyalty to your channel. Some limitations that must be through of when designing Idents are getting the right amount and balance of typography in the Ident. Also you need to make sure the resolution is right for what displays you want your Ident shown of for example a TVs resolution wont be the same as on the IPAD. Another limitation is that you have to make sure you use colours that will attract the eyes of the viewers and your target audience. The aspect ratio has to be correct so the picture fits in all the screens and is not half cut out.
